Project Profile: PV System Voltage Stabilization for Polish Supermarket Chain
Client: A leading supermarket chain in Poland
Challenge: Voltage Rise Leading to PV Curtailment and Revenue Loss
The Problem: Grid Instability Limiting Solar ROI
Following the successful installation of rooftop PV systems across multiple stores, the client faced a critical issue. During peak solar generation hours, especially in areas with weak grid infrastructure, the voltage at the point of connection would frequently exceed the EN 50160 standard limits.
This caused their PV inverters to automatically trip or derate, resulting in:
Significant lost solar generation during the most productive hours.
Reduced ROI on their PV investment.
Non-compliance with grid connection requirements for reactive power support.
